This is a known issue with the latest quantum release. Verizon is working on a fix but as of yet, there is no release date.

I have found that if you find a series that isn't recording do the following:

Chose the series.

Chose modify series.

Make no changes and then save.

I haven't had any series repeat.

I have been having the same problem since March and have spoken to them several times with no resoloution.             Last Thursday, they were able to send me an update while i was on the phone with them and it seems to have fixed it ( It's been 5 days with no issue).

The version you need is:

Release 3.1

Build 06.55

UI version 06.54

Firmware KA15.16.16.03Alder.547911

You can check what version you have by going into menu>settings>system information
